Understanding the SAT Format

The Scholastic Assessment Test (SAT) is a standardized test that evaluates your readiness for college. The vocabulary section typically falls under the Reading Test and the Writing and Language Test. It is designed to assess your grasp of language, context, and comprehension skills.

Structure of the Exam

  • Reading Test: Consists of 52 multiple-choice questions based on passages. Vocabulary in context is one of the skills tested.
  • Writing and Language Test: Includes 44 multiple-choice questions. Vocabulary questions here often revolve around identifying and correcting word choice errors.

Both sections measure your ability to understand complex texts, draw inferences, and apply vocabulary in context—all skills crucial for college success.

What to Expect in the Vocabulary Section

When tackling the SAT vocabulary questions, here's what you can expect:

  • Contextual Understanding: Questions often ask you to determine the meaning of a word based on its context in the passage.
  • Nuanced Meanings: Recognizing subtle differences in word usage is key to answering these questions correctly.
  • Evolving Words: The 2025 version might introduce newly prevalent words and phrases, reflecting contemporary language usage.

The emphasis is on words that are commonly found in college-level readings, making it essential to focus on understanding words in context rather than rote memorization.

Advanced Study Techniques

  • Root Words and Etymology: Understand the origins of words. Many English words derive from Latin and Greek roots, which can help you deduce the meanings of unfamiliar words.
  • Synonyms and Antonyms: Expand your vocabulary by learning related words, helping you to understand nuanced differences and choose the correct term in context.
  • Word Maps: Create visual diagrams that connect words with similar meanings, context, and usage.
